ORA-14112: RECOVERABLE/UNRECOVERABLE may not be specified for a partition or subpartition

文档解释

ORA-14112: RECOVERABLE/UNRECOVERABLE may not be specified for a partition or subpartition

Cause: Description of a partition or subpartition found in CREATE TABLE/INDEX statement contained RECOVERABLE or UNRECOVERABLE clause which is illegal

Action: Remove offending clause. Use LOGGING or NOLOGGING instead.

ORA-14112: RECOVERABLE/UNRECOVERABLE 只能用在以下条件:

官方解释

在Oracle数据库中,ORA-14112错误表明,用户指定的RECOVERABLE / UNRECOVERABLE参数不允许表或表的子分区。通常,ORA-14112错误的解决方案是取消该参数的使用并使用适当的参数。

常见案例

ORA-14112错误通常发生在尝试指定RECOVERABLE / UNRECOVERABLE参数创建子分区时。例如,在以下查询中,用户尝试在表的子分区上指定RECOVERABLE参数,从而导致ORA-14112问题。

正常处理方法及步骤

处理ORA-14112错误的常用解决方案如下:

1.检查分区/子分区内部是否指定了RECOVERABLE / UNRECOVERABLE参数。

2.如果RECOVERABLE / UNRECOVERABLE参数被指定,则应取消参数的使用。

3.编辑查询以使用更适合的参数。

4.确保使用的参数适用于指定的分区/子分区。

5.运行更新查询,如果没有错误,ORA-14112问题应该被解决。

你可能感兴趣的